Position Summary
The Golf Course Maintenance - General Laborer is responsible for assisting in the daily maintenance and upkeep of the golf course landscaping and club grounds. This position plays an important role in ensuring the course is maintained to club standards and provides an exceptional playing experience for members and guests.
Essential Responsibilities
Mow greens tees fairways roughs and other turf areas as assigned
Perform bunker maintenance including raking edging and sand upkeep
Assist with golf course setup including tee markers cups ropes signage and ball washers
Operate hand tools blowers trimmers utility vehicles and maintenance equipment safely
Assist with irrigation repairs watering and drainage projects
Perform landscaping duties including trimming planting mulching pruning and weed removal
Remove debris leaves fallen branches and trash from the course and grounds
Assist with fertilizer and pesticide applications under supervision
Help prepare the course for tournaments special events and daily play
Maintain a clean safe and organized work environment
Follow all safety procedures and club policies
